PLC TechnicianJob DescriptionOur company is looking for a skilled PLC Technician to join our dynamic team. You will be responsible for troubleshooting, diagnosing, and repairing damaged and/or malfunctioning robotic systems, equipment, and components. You will also assist in the development and selection of diagnostic test and troubleshooting tools, devices, and fixtures. Your role will include maintaining good housekeeping of tools, equipment and repair area, as well as developing proposals for equipment purchase, maintenance and operation instructions. This role also involves assuming responsibility for the completion of assigned projects within negotiated time and cost schedules. Other duties may be assigned as needed.Hard Skills

5+ years experience with assembly and troubleshooting

Ability to read blueprints and complex mechanical drawings

Experience in robotics

Soft Skills

Ability to manage projects

Good housekeeping skills

Ability to develop and maintain detailed repair activities reports
